In its latest financial quarter, Pathward Financial, Inc. demonstrates strong financial performance and strategic risk management practices. The company reports a net income attributable to the parent of US$72.9 million, resulting in a diluted earnings per share (EPS) of US$3.35. It has also increased its allowance for credit losses to US$98.3 million, indicating a proactive approach in adapting to evolving economic conditions. This move aligns with Pathward's objective of strengthening its balance sheet to navigate uncertainties in the financial landscape.
